If youre searching for a way into the computing sector – whether thats creating smartphone apps, connecting businesses, or helping communities talk to each other, this course is for you!

The HND in Computing serves as a pathway to a career in the computing field. It enhances your technical expertise through practical learning and a comprehensive exploration of the computing industry.

You will expand your knowledge, understanding, and skills to:

Standard entry applicants must have a sound academic profile, represented by: - Two GCSEs at Grade C or above, to include English or Welsh Language and Mathematics/Numeracy (or equivalent qualifications) - Level 3 qualification: - 88 UCAS tariff points from at least 2 A Levels. (The Level 3 Advanced Skills Baccalaureate will be considered). - QCF BTEC Extended Diploma with an overall grade of Merit-Merit-Pass - 48 UCAS tariff points (at least a Pass for 45 credits) from an Access to Higher Education Diploma.
